Historical Overview

Dubai Marina's inception traces back to the late 1990s, conceived as part of the ambitious Dubai Waterfront project. Originally, the vision was simple: transform desert land into a thriving coastal community. Fast forward to today, and this vision has materialized spectacularly.

The project was spearheaded by Emaar Properties, a name synonymous with luxury and innovation in real estate. The goal was to create a mixed-use space that would appeal to both residents and tourists. Major developments began in the early 2000s, and within a few short years, the skyline began to fill with distinctive towers, each with its own character.

By the end of 2003, the area began seeing the rise of residential buildings and establishments aimed at catering to a growing population drawn by the allure of living near the water. Early on, many expatriates settled in this burgeoning community, attracted to its unique lifestyle, accessibility, and the promise of modern comforts. Gradually, a plethora of amenities emerged, ranging from waterfront restaurants to shopping venues, fortifying the community's reputation as a premier lifestyle destination.

Key Features of Dubai Marina

Dubai Marina is characterized by its stunning waterfront views and a unique blend of architectural styles, setting it apart from other urban developments. Here are several key aspects:

  • Marina Walk: A scenic promenade that invites residents and visitors alike to enjoy leisurely strolls while dining at upscale cafes or shopping at boutique stores.
  • The Beach: A beautiful public beach nearby provides an oasis of relaxation amidst the city's hustle and bustle, complete with recreational activities and family-friendly facilities.
  • High-rise Buildings: The skyline showcases striking skyscrapers equipped with modern amenities, offering breathtaking views of the sea and cityscape.
  • Community Living: Unlike traditional apartment complexes, many buildings offer a sense of community through communal gardens, pools, and children's play areas, enhancing the living experience.
  • Transport Links: With easy access to the Dubai Metro and major roads, connectivity to the rest of Dubai is seamless, making daily commutes manageable and convenient.

Components of the Marina Quays Complex

Marina Quays comprises three residential towers: Quays 1, Quays 2, and Quays 3, each offering unique living arrangements and amenities. The blend of spacious apartments—ranging from stylish studios to expansive three-bedroom units—caters to a diverse demographic. With waterfront views and modern interiors, there's something for everyone.

The complex is more than just living spaces; it includes:

  • Retail Options: A mixture of boutique shops and eateries scattered throughout the complex. Residents can enjoy everything from casual snacks to gourmet dining, providing a vibrant culinary scene right outside their door.
  • Leisure Facilities: Pools, gyms, and green spaces dot the complex, encouraging healthy living and recreation. Families find ample playgrounds and sports facilities, while tranquil gardens offer spots for respite.
  • Accessibility: Located near major road networks and public transport, residents have the city at their fingertips. Whether commuting or seeking entertainment, ease of movement is a cornerstone of life at Marina Quays.

Rental Yields and Property Values

Understanding rental yields and property values is essential for any investor contemplating Marina Quays. Over recent years, this area has consistently reported competitive rental returns, making it a lucrative market for landlords. Current estimates suggest that rental yields in Marina Quays can reach upwards of 6-8%, depending on the type of property and its specific location within the vicinity.

Market Fluctuations

The real estate market in Dubai is notorious for its unpredictable nature. With prices soaring and slumping over short periods, this volatility poses a significant challenge for investors. The demand for properties in Dubai Marina can sometimes reflect broader economic trends, both locally and globally. For example, during economic downturns or periods of geopolitical instability, many might think twice about investing in luxury properties.

Key elements influencing market fluctuations include:

  • Economic Performance: The state of the UAE economy greatly affects the property market. A flourishing economy typically translates to increased investment, with more expats looking for homes in prime locations like Dubai Marina.
  • Supply and Demand: The introduction of new developments can saturate the market, pushing prices down. Conversely, if demand outstrips supply, property values can skyrocket, making it an uphill battle for prospective buyers.

Investors should keep a keen eye on market indicators such as:

  • Economic reports and forecasts
  • Changes in mortgage rates
  • Population growth figures

Tracking these factors can provide insights into when to buy or sell, ensuring that decisions are made with ample information rather than speculation. It's vital for those looking to invest in properties within the Marina to approach the market with both caution and strategic foresight.

Regulatory Environment

Intertwined with market fluctuations is the regulatory landscape that governs real estate activities in Dubai. Changes in laws and regulations can create both obstacles and opportunities for investors and homeowners alike.

Regulations are designed to protect buyers and ensure that the market remains stable. However, navigating these waters can be complicated, particularly for foreign investors. Here are some key considerations:

  • Ownership Restrictions: While Dubai allows foreign ownership in designated areas, potential buyers must be aware of their rights and any regulations that could affect them. Understanding local laws can prevent costly mistakes.
  • Property Registration: Every transaction must comply with specific registration processes to ensure proper title transfer and security. Delays in registration or misunderstandings can frustrate new buyers.
  • Rental Laws: For investors considering rental properties, familiarizing oneself with local rental laws is essential. Regulations might dictate rental prices, tenant rights, and lease agreements, creating a complex environment for landlords to navigate.

Overall, the regulatory environment can be as dynamic as market fluctuations. As policies evolve in response to economic pressures or shifts in demand, staying informed becomes a fundamental aspect of strategic investing in the Marina area.
